The central jewel of this butterfly-shaped brooch swirls with multicolored iridescence.
The brooch has 3 charges and regains all expended charges daily at dawn. As a Reaction when a creature you can
see within 60 feet of you hits a target with an attack roll and deals damage, you can expend 1 charge and change one damage type the attack deals to one of the following damage types: Acid, Cold, Fire, Lightning, Poison, or Thunder.

Regaining Charges. The mask regains 1d3 expended charges daily at dawn. If you expend the last charge, roll 1d20. On a 1, the mask explodes in a harmless cloud of sweet-swelling powder and is destroyed.
